What is APTC Form 101

The APTC Form 101 is a government payment request form used by Indian government employees to process payments. It requires multiple signatures to ensure proper authorization.

Field-by-Field Instructions for APTC Form 101

The APTC Form 101 includes several key fields that must be filled out correctly. For instance, the DDO code must reflect the proper authority associated with the payment request, while the PAO code identifies the financial accounting unit.
Other critical fields include the bill number and the exact amount to be paid. Each of these sections is essential for validating the payment request and ensuring appropriate disbursement. Visual aids can be helpful in illustrating exactly what information should be placed in each field.

The APTC Form 101 is primarily for government employees in India seeking payment. It requires signatures from the requesting employee, DDO, and Treasury Officer for processing.
Typically, supporting documents would include your identification as a government employee, the DDO code, PAO code, and any relevant bills related to your payment request.
Once the form is completed and signed, you can submit it electronically through pdfFiller or print it for physical submission according to your department's submission guidelines.
Common mistakes include forgetting to obtain all necessary signatures, entering incorrect DDO or PAO codes, and leaving required fields blank. Double-check all entries before submitting.
Processing times can vary based on department schedules and workflows. Typically, allow 1-2 weeks for processing after the APTC Form 101 is submitted.
